Nokia dominated mobile phone sales in 2006 Nokia dominated mobile phone sales in 2006Market research firm Gartner said in a statement that the global mobile phone sales in the world markets fell just short of a billion units in 2006.The market saw sales exceeding 990.8 million units last year. Nokia To Supply WCDMA 3G Radio And Core Network Services To RCS & RDS In Romania - Update (RTTNews) - Friday, mobile phone manufacturer Nokia Corp.(NOK) said that it has been selected by Romanian fixed and greenfield mobile operator, RCS & RDS, as its WCDMA 3G core and radio network supplier. RC & RDS has recently launched its 3G service, the company noted.
